Abstract
We consider the classical self-dual Yang-Mills equation in 3+1-dimensional Minkowski space. We have found an exact solution, which describes scattering of plane waves. In order to write the solution in a compact form, it is convenient to introduce a scattering operator . It acts in the direct product of three linear spaces: 1) universal enveloping of Lie algebra, 2) -dimensional vector space and 3) space of functions defined on the unit interval.
